高效生成XML网站地图 SEO优化必备工具
XML网站地图生成:提升SEO效率的关键步骤

在网站优化中,XML网站地图(XML Sitemap)是搜索引擎爬虫快速发现和索引页面的重要工具。无论是新站还是老站,合理生成并提交XML网站地图都能显著提升收录效率。本文将详细介绍XML网站地图的作用、生成方法以及优化技巧,帮助你的网站在百度等搜索引擎中获得更好的表现。
一、XML网站地图的核心作用
XML网站地图本质上是一个包含网站所有重要页面URL的标准化文件,它通过清晰的层级结构向搜索引擎传递页面信息。对于百度SEO而言,XML地图能解决三个核心问题:一是帮助爬虫快速发现新页面,尤其是内容量大的网站;二是明确页面优先级和更新频率,引导搜索引擎合理分配抓取资源;三是解决复杂网站结构导致的收录遗漏问题,比如动态URL或深层目录页面。
二、如何生成XML网站地图
生成XML网站地图并不需要技术背景,主流方法有三种:一是使用在线工具(如XML-Sitemaps.com),输入网址即可自动生成;二是通过CMS插件(如WordPress的Yoast SEO)一键创建;三是手动编写代码,适合定制化需求。无论哪种方式,需确保包含所有重要页面,且文件格式符合标准(通常为sitemap.xml)。生成后,建议通过百度搜索资源平台提交,并定期更新以反映网站最新状态。
三、XML网站地图的优化技巧
想让XML网站地图发挥最大价值,需注意以下细节:优先包含高权重页面(如首页、核心产品页),并标注<priority>属性;对频繁更新的内容(如博客)设置<changefreq>为“daily”或“weekly”;避免地图文件过大(建议不超过50MB或5万条URL),可通过分卷或压缩解决。多语言网站应使用hreflang标注,确保搜索引擎理解页面语言版本。
四、常见问题与解决方案
许多站长会遇到XML地图未被百度收录的情况,这可能源于三个原因:一是地图未提交或提交失败,需检查百度搜索资源平台的反馈;二是地图中存在死链或低质量页面,建议定期用工具(如Screaming Frog)检测;三是服务器配置问题,如robots.txt屏蔽或返回错误状态码。解决后,可配合主动推送功能加速收录。
总结来说,XML网站地图是SEO优化中不可或缺的一环。通过规范生成和持续维护,不仅能提升爬虫抓取效率,还能间接影响关键词排名。建议站长结合自身网站特点,定期审查地图文件,让搜索引擎与用户更高效地获取你的内容。





